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SAPAPO/AHT -
Message number: 701
Message text: Value for parameter &1 can be a maximum of &2 characters long

- Value for parameter &1 can be a maximum of &2 characters long ?The SAP error message
/SAPAPO/AHT701
indicates that a value for a specific parameter exceeds the maximum allowed character length. This error typically occurs in the context of S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) when a user tries to input or process data that does not conform to the defined limits for that parameter.Cause:
